
LEARN NC (http://www.learnnc.org/) and NCVPS have been partners for the last three years in providing innovative programming for North Carolina educators and stakeholders. Recently, my Chief Technology Officer (CTO), Chanin Rivenbark and I were asked to do two separate webinars from our GO LIVE effort (http://sites.google.com/site/ncvpsgolive/) for 30 Chief Technology Officers around the state as a part of LEARN NC's partnerships with the School of Government's CeCTO program http://www.sog.unc.edu/.
The focus of these webinars is how students and teachers use Web 2.0 for learning, with some discussion of open source, cost savings, implications of a remix & share culture, moving toward modular/blended learning, and how CTO’s can support and lead this type of environment. Because of NCVPS' unique work in the areas of 21st Century Leadership and Innovation, Dr. Setser and Mrs. Rivenbark have recorded two short, fifteen minute webinars below to help Superintendents and CTO’s in their planning for district wide technology savings, strategic planning, and implementation.
